What are the must-visit attractions in Da Nang?
Da Nang's main attractions blend natural landscapes with cultural landmarks. The Marble Mountains contain ancient pagodas and notable caves including Tang Chon and Am Phu. The Golden Bridge at Ba Na Hills stands at 1,487m offering clear views across the region while the Lady Buddha statue reaches 70m high at Linh Ung Pagoda with sweeping coastal vistas. What's the best time of year to visit Da Nang?
February through May provides ideal conditions in Da Nang with mild weather and limited rain. Daily temperatures range from 25-28°C (77-82°F) making it comfortable to explore outdoor sites like Ba Na Hills and My Son Sanctuary. Summer brings intense heat and humidity while the heaviest rains fall from September through January. What cultural sites should I visit in Da Nang?
The city's cultural heritage shines at several key locations. The Cham Museum displays the world's most extensive collection of Cham artifacts. The Dragon Bridge puts on fire shows each weekend while Linh Ung Pagoda sits majestically on Son Tra Peninsula. Nearby My Son Sanctuary a UNESCO site presents ancient Champa architecture. What are the best food experiences in Da Nang?
Local markets like Con Market and Han Market serve as food hubs where visitors can try Mi Quang (turmeric noodles with pork and shrimp) Banh Mi Ba Lan (Vietnamese sandwich) and fresh seafood along the Han River. Tra Que Vegetable Village offers hands-on cooking classes using just-picked ingredients. What are the best day trips from Da Nang?
Short excursions include the UNESCO-listed Hoi An Ancient Town (30 minutes away) the Imperial City of Hue (2 hours) and My Son Sanctuary known for its Cham ruins. Bach Ma National Park provides excellent hiking trails.
